About Eugene H. Peterson
Eugene H. Peterson was a 20th-century American author and translator. Eugene Hoiland Peterson was an American Presbyterian minister, scholar, theologian, author, and poet. He wrote more than 30 books, including the Gold Medallion Book Award–winner The Message: The Bible in Contemporary Language, an idiomatic paraphrasing commentary and translation of the Bible into modern American English using a dynamic equivalence translation approach.
